Valentine’s flowers blossom as nor’easter fades away
PROVIDENCE, R.I. (WLNE) — Many locals showed their Valentine’s Day love by treating their special someone to a special something like flowers.
Studio 539 Flowers in Providence said the phones have been ringing off the hook, people have been running in to pick up online orders, and last minute shoppers were making their way in on Wednesday.
“It’s been a fantastic day for Valentine’s Day,” said Grace Dugan, owner of Studio 539 Flowers. “Sun was shining, phones have been ringing, folks have been running in picking up orders that they preordered.”
“Also flowers are available for pickup today,” Dugan added.
Valentine’s Day is one of the shop’s busiest days of the year, and was it was fortunate to land on Wednesday rather than Tuesday with the recent snow storm.
Shoppers made their way in to Studio 539 Flowers to surprise their loved ones.
“There is a girl that I have liked for awhile, I have been crushing on her for bit,” said customer Darren Lopes Jr. “I have got to do something, it’s Valentine’s Day. Can’t let this day pass without showing some kind of affection.”
The shop was able to make some deliveries on Tuesday in the storm, but with the parking ban in the city of Providence it was difficult for shoppers to get their flowers.
For Valentine’s Day alone, Studio 539 had between 200 and 300 orders, with 100 of them being delivered.
Plenty of people also walked in to pick up an online order or shop around in person.
“When it comes to flowers I could have definitely done it a day or two ahead of time,” Lopes Jr. said. “I don’t know everything there is to know about flowers. I would rather it be in their hands and pick them up as fresh as possible.”
“Now I know I can order ahead of time,” Lopes Jr. added. “Maybe I’ll do that for 2025.”
According to the owner, the price of flowers has gone up, similar to many other things.
“Flowers have followed food,” Dugan said. “Everything has really gone up a lot. Stamps, post office, gas. It’s a beautiful luxury.”
